CROCK POT PEPPER STEAK



Crock Pot Pepper Steak image

Crock pot pepper steak is an easy homemade version of the classic Chinese American dish. Bell peppers and tender beef in a rich, thick sauce made with ginger, soy sauce and honey.

Number Of Ingredients 17

2 pounds sirloin (cut into 2-inch, by ½-inch strips)
2 teaspoons garlic powder
½ teaspoon kosher salt
1/2 teaspoon black pepper
1 tablespoon canola oil (grapeseed oil, or a different neutral oil)
1 large yellow onion
¼ cup (plus 2 tablespoons water, divided)
2 green bell peppers (cored and cut into ½-inch strips)
2 red, yellow, or orange bell peppers (cored and cut into ½-inch strips)
1 15-ounce can fire roasted diced tomatoes in their juices
¼ cup low sodium soy sauce (plus additional to taste)
2 tablespoons Worcestershire sauce
2 tablespoons honey
1 tablespoon minced fresh ginger
¼ teaspoon red pepper flakes (plus additional to taste)
5 tablespoons cornstarch (divided)
Prepared brown rice (quinoa or cauliflower rice, for serving)

Steps:

  • Place the beef in a bowl and sprinkle with the garlic powder, salt, and black pepper. Toss to coat.
  • Heat the oil in a large skillet over medium high. Add the beef and cook on all sides until the beef is lightly browned, about 5 minutes (no need to cook it all the way through). Transfer the beef and any cooking juices to a 6-quart slow cooker.
  • To the skillet where you were just cooking the beef, add the onions. Increase the heat to high. Carefully pour in 1/4 cup water, stirring to scrape up any browned bits stuck on the pan. Sauté until the onions begin to soften and lightly brown and the liquid has cooked off, about 3 minutes, then transfer the onions to the slow cooker with the beef.
  • To the slow cooker, add the green and red bell peppers (see recipe note) and tomatoes. In a small bowl or a large liquid measuring cup, whisk together the soy sauce, Worcestershire sauce, honey, ginger, red pepper flakes, and 3 tablespoons cornstarch. Pour into the slow cooker.
  • Cover and cook on LOW for 6 to 7 hours, until the beef is tender (you can also make this recipe on HIGH, cooking it for 3 to 4 hours, though I find the beef comes out more tender on low heat).
  • In a small bowl, whisk together the remaining 2 tablespoons cornstarch with the remaining 2 tablespoons water to make a slurry. Stir the slurry into the slow cooker. Turn the slow cooker to HIGH and let cook, uncovered, for 10 minutes to further thicken. The pepper beef will still be saucy, but it should resemble a thick, rich gravy. Stir once more. Taste and add additional salt, soy sauce, and/or red pepper flakes to taste. Serve hot with prepared brown rice and a sprinkle of green onion.

CROCKPOT PEPPER STEAK RECIPE

Number Of Ingredients 10

1.5 lbs round steak ((cut into thin strips) )
1 green bell pepper ((sliced thick))
1 red bell pepper ((sliced thick))
1/2 onion ((sliced thick))
1 1/2 cups beef broth
3 Tbsp soy sauce
1/4 tsp ground ginger
1/4 tsp garlic powder
1/4 tsp black pepper
2 tsp brown sugar

Steps:

  • Place the beef, bell peppers and onions in a slow cooker.
  • Add the seasonings, brown sugar, and soy sauce over the beef and peppers.
  • Pour the beef broth in the crock pot.
  • Stir to combine.
  • Cover and cook on low for 5-6 hours or on high for 2.5-3 hours until the steak is cooked through.
  • Serve over a bed of white rice.

SLOW-COOKER PEPPER STEAK



Slow-Cooker Pepper Steak image

Very tender and flavorful, this recipe is one of our family's favorites. It's great to make ahead of time in the slow cooker and then serve over rice, egg noodles, or chow mein.

Number Of Ingredients 12

2 pounds beef sirloin, cut into 2 inch strips
garlic powder to taste
3 tablespoons vegetable oil
1 cube beef bouillon
¼ cup hot water
1 tablespoon cornstarch
½ cup chopped onion
2 large green bell peppers, roughly chopped
1 (14.5 ounce) can stewed tomatoes, with liquid
3 tablespoons soy sauce
1 teaspoon white sugar
1 teaspoon salt

Steps:

  • Sprinkle strips of sirloin with garlic powder to taste. In a large skillet over medium heat, heat the vegetable oil and brown the seasoned beef strips. Transfer to a slow cooker.
  • Mix bouillon cube with hot water until dissolved, then mix in cornstarch until dissolved. Pour into the slow cooker with meat. Stir in onion, green peppers, stewed tomatoes, soy sauce, sugar, and salt.
  • Cover, and cook on High for 3 to 4 hours, or on Low for 6 to 8 hours.

SLOW-COOKED PEPPER STEAK



Slow-Cooked Pepper Steak image

After a long day working in our greenhouse raising bedding plants, I enjoy coming in to this hearty beef dish for supper. It's one of my favorite meals. - Sue Gronholz, Beaver Dam, Wisconsin

Number Of Ingredients 14

1-1/2 pounds beef top round steak
2 tablespoons canola oil
1 cup chopped onion
1/4 cup reduced-sodium soy sauce
1 garlic clove, minced
1 teaspoon sugar
1/2 teaspoon salt
1/4 teaspoon ground ginger
1/4 teaspoon pepper
4 medium tomatoes, cut into wedges or 1 can (14-1/2 ounces) diced tomatoes, undrained
1 large green pepper, cut into strips
1 tablespoon cornstarch
1/2 cup cold water
Hot cooked noodles or rice

Steps:

  • Cut beef into 3x1-in. strips. In a large skillet, brown beef in oil. Transfer to a 3-qt. slow cooker. Combine the onion, soy sauce, garlic, sugar, salt, ginger and pepper; pour over beef. Cover and cook on low until meat is tender, for 5-6 hours. Add tomatoes and green pepper; cook on low until vegetables are tender, about 1 hour longer., Combine cornstarch and cold water until smooth; gradually stir into slow cooker. Cover and cook on high until thickened, 20-30 minutes. Serve with noodles or rice. Freeze option: Freeze cooled beef mixture in freezer containers. To use, partially thaw in refrigerator overnight. Heat through in a covered saucepan, stirring gently. Add a little broth or water if necessary.

SLOW-COOKER PEPPER STEAK



Slow-Cooker Pepper Steak image

Pepper steak is one of my favorite dishes, but sometimes the beef can be tough. This recipe solves that problem! The slow cooker keeps things simple and makes the meat very tender. I've stored leftovers in one big resealable bag and also in individual portions for quick lunches. -Julie Rhine, Zelienople, Pennsylvania

Number Of Ingredients 11

1 beef top round roast (3 pounds)
1 large onion, halved and sliced
1 large green pepper, cut into 1/2-inch strips
1 large sweet red pepper, cut into 1/2-inch strips
1 cup water
4 garlic cloves, minced
1/3 cup cornstarch
1/2 cup reduced-sodium soy sauce
2 teaspoons sugar
2 teaspoons ground ginger
8 cups hot cooked brown rice

Steps:

  • Place roast, onion and peppers in a 5-qt. slow cooker. Add water and garlic. Cook, covered, on low until meat is tender, 6-8 hours., Remove beef to a cutting board. Transfer vegetables and cooking juices to a large saucepan. Bring to a boil. In a small bowl, mix cornstarch, soy sauce, sugar and ginger until smooth; stir into vegetable mixture. Return to a boil, stirring constantly; cook and stir until thickened, 1-2 minutes., Cut beef into slices. Stir gently into sauce; heat through. Serve with rice. Freeze option: Freeze cooled beef mixture in freezer containers. To use, partially thaw in refrigerator overnight. Heat through in a saucepan, stirring occasionally; add a little water if necessary.

SLOW-COOKER STUFFED PEPPERS



Slow-Cooker Stuffed Peppers image

There's a whole lot to love about stuffed peppers. They're hearty, made with inexpensive ingredients and they taste great-even to veggie skeptics. And now, they're slow-cooker friendly! Spend 20 minutes prepping and you can walk away for the rest of the day, as this slow-cooker stuffed pepper recipe cooks for around five hours.

Number Of Ingredients 9

6 large bell peppers
1 lb ground beef (at least 80% lean)
1 cup finely chopped onions
1 teaspoon salt
1 teaspoon black pepper
6 cloves garlic, finely chopped
1 1/2 cups cooked white rice
1 can (15 oz) Muir Glen™ organic tomato sauce
2 cups shredded cheddar cheese (8 oz)

Steps:

  • Spray 6-quart oval slow cooker with cooking spray. Trim tops off bell peppers; remove ribs and seeds. Set aside.
  • In 12-inch nonstick skillet over medium-high heat, cook beef, onions, salt and pepper 8 to 10 minutes, stirring frequently, until beef is cooked through and onion softens. Add garlic; cook 15 seconds. Drain.
  • Stir rice and 1/2 cup of the tomato sauce into beef mixture in skillet; mix to combine. Stir in 1 cup of the cheese. Stuff peppers with beef mixture; arrange in slow cooker. Pour remaining tomato sauce over peppers.
  • Cover; cook on Low heat setting 4 1/2 to 5 1/2 hours or until peppers are soft. Top peppers with remaining 1 cup cheese. Cover; cook 3 to 8 minutes longer or until cheese is melted. Use slotted spoon to lift peppers from slow cooker.

SLOW COOKER STUFFED PEPPERS



Slow Cooker Stuffed Peppers image

These are slow-cooked stuffed peppers. Red or yellow bell peppers can be used instead of green. Italian diced tomatoes can be used in place of fire-roasted if desired.

Number Of Ingredients 8

1 pound lean ground beef
1 (14.5 ounce) can fire-roasted diced tomatoes
1 cup cooked rice
2 tablespoons ketchup
1 teaspoon Worcestershire sauce
1 teaspoon ground black pepper
6 green bell peppers, tops and seeds removed (reserve tops)
⅓ cup water

Steps:

  • Heat a large skillet over medium-high heat. Cook and stir beef in the hot skillet until browned and crumbly, 5 to 7 minutes; drain and discard grease.
  • Mix ground beef, tomatoes, rice, ketchup, Worcestershire sauce, and black pepper together in a bowl. Stuff each green bell pepper with ground beef mixture.
  • Arrange stuffed bell peppers in the crock of a slow cooker; place the reserved tops back onto each bell pepper. Pour water around the base of each stuffed bell pepper.
  • Cook on Low for 6 to 8 hours.

SLOW-COOKER PEPPER STEAK



Slow-Cooker Pepper Steak image

Flavors of ginger and soy sauce blend during slow cooking to make a delicious beef dinner.

Number Of Ingredients 11

1 1/2 lb boneless beef round steak
2 medium onions, cut into 1/4-inch slices
1 clove garlic, finely chopped
1/2 teaspoon finely chopped gingerroot or 1/4 teaspoon ground ginger
1 cup Progresso™ beef flavored broth (from 32-oz carton)
3 tablespoons soy sauce
2 tablespoons cornstarch
1/4 cup cold water
2 medium green bell peppers, cut into 3/4-inch strips
2 medium tomatoes, cut into eighths
6 cups hot cooked rice

Steps:

  • Remove fat from beef. Cut beef into 6 serving pieces. Spray 12-inch skillet with cooking spray; heat over medium-high heat. Cook beef in skillet about 8 minutes, turning once, until brown.
  • In 3- to 4-quart slow cooker, layer beef, onions, garlic and gingerroot. In small bowl, mix broth and soy sauce; pour over beef.
  • Cover; cook on Low heat setting 7 to 9 hours or until beef is tender.
  • In small bowl, mix cornstarch and water; gradually stir into beef mixture. Stir in bell peppers. Increase heat setting to High. Cover; cook 10 to 12 minutes or until slightly thickened. Stir in tomatoes. Cover; cook about 3 minutes longer or just until tomatoes are thoroughly heated. Serve over rice.

Tips:

Mise en Place: Before you start cooking, make sure you have all of your ingredients and equipment ready to go. This will help you stay organized and avoid any scrambling. Brown the Beef: Browning the beef before adding it to the slow cooker will help to enhance its flavor and give it a nice crust. Use High-Quality Ingredients: The quality of your ingredients will greatly impact the flavor of your dish. Use fresh vegetables, tender cuts of meat, and flavorful spices. Add Some Liquid: Adding a little bit of liquid to the slow cooker will help to prevent the beef and peppers from drying out. You can use water, beef broth, or even a little bit of wine. Cook on Low and Slow: The best way to cook beef and peppers in a slow cooker is on low and slow. This will allow the flavors to develop and the beef to become tender and fall-apart. Season to Taste: Once the beef and peppers are cooked, season them to taste with salt, pepper, and any other desired spices.
